Tournament structure and sekolah coverage
The Champions League begins with qualifying rounds where teams from smaller federations compete for group-stage spots. We at sekolah cover these qualifying matches, though our primary focus intensifies once the group stage begins. The group stage features 32 teams divided into eight groups of four. Each team plays six matches (home and away against each opponent in their group). Our sekolah platform displays group standings, goal differentials, and head-to-head records in real time.
The knockout phase begins with the Round of 16, followed by quarterfinals, semifinals, and the final. We track all fixtures and update our sekolah bracket as teams advance.
